Job Description

RESPEC is seeking an experienced Azure Database Engineer to support a Minnesota public-sector client on a high-impact child welfare modernization initiative. As a RESPEC consultant, you will join a mission-driven team working to strengthen data infrastructure that supports services for children, youth, and families across Minnesota.

Role Summary

This role will help advance the modernization of Minnesota's child welfare information environment through the implementation of a Comprehensive Child Welfare Information System (CCWIS). A central component of this effort is consolidating data from 87 county databases into a centralized Azure-based data lake environment that will support a future enterprise solution.

The Azure Database Engineer will contribute across analysis, design, development, implementation, administration, maintenance, and security of Azure databases and Data Lakehouse capabilities. This individual will also collaborate with technical and business stakeholders, improve data workflows, help protect sensitive information, and mentor other database engineers.

Core Responsibilities
  • Design, develop, implement, administer, and maintain Azure database and data lake solutions supporting the CCWIS modernization program.
  • Support the development and ongoing evolution of a centralized Data Lakehouse and integrated data reserves.
  • Help consolidate and prepare data originating from 87 county database environments for use within a centralized platform.
  • Implement and maintain data security, integrity, governance, availability, and reliability practices within Azure environments.
  • Analyze and optimize data workflows to improve performance, usability, and data-driven decision-making.
  • Partner with cross-functional teams, including technical, program, and business stakeholders, to deliver scalable data solutions.
  • Provide technical guidance and mentorship to other Database Engineers.
  • Potentially provide ongoing operational support following implementation.

Qualifications

Required Technical Experience

Candidates should demonstrate strong, relevant experience in the following areas:
  • Azure database engineering, administration, maintenance, and security.
  • Azure Data Lakes, Data Lakehouse platforms, and centralized data-storage solutions.
  • Database analysis, design, development, and implementation.
  • Data integration, workflow optimization, data integrity, and data-security practices.
  • Working collaboratively across cross-functional technical and business teams.
  • Providing technical mentorship to other database engineering professionals.

Preferred Qualifications

Experience supporting large-scale public-sector data modernization programs, child welfare systems, multi-source data consolidation, or enterprise cloud migrations would be highly relevant to this engagement.
